Core Insights - The concept of embodied intelligence is gaining traction, with humanoid robots becoming a focal point in the industry despite facing challenges in technology and costs [1] - The introduction of the 5G-A humanoid robot "Kua Fu" marks a significant advancement in overcoming network bottlenecks that have hindered the development of humanoid robots [3][12] Group 1: Technological Advancements - "Kua Fu" integrates 5G-A technology into humanoid robots, enabling high-precision positioning, low latency, real-time remote control, edge computing, and cloud collaboration [3] - The deployment of 5G-A technology significantly reduces the cost of multi-robot networking and facilitates precise collaborative operations in industrial environments [3] - The release of the "5G-A Empowering Information Consumption 'New Three Samples' White Paper" defines key capability indicators and interface specifications necessary for humanoid robots supported by 5G-A networks [5] Group 2: Market Potential - Predictions indicate that by 2025, China's humanoid robot production will exceed 10,000 units, with a market size expected to reach 8.239 billion yuan, capturing half of the global market [8] - By 2045, the number of humanoid robots in use in China is projected to surpass 100 million, with the overall market size potentially reaching approximately 10 trillion yuan [8] Group 3: Industry Collaboration - The collaboration between Leju Robotics, China Mobile, and Huawei has resulted in the successful development and demonstration of the "Kua Fu" robot, showcasing its capabilities in real-world applications [3][10] - Leju Robotics aims to deepen its partnership with China Mobile and Huawei to further integrate 5G-A technology with humanoid robots, creating scalable and commercially viable applications [10]
